Practical Seller Notes and Technical Due Diligence
Before adding this digital embroidery file to your commercial rotation, there are critical practical steps to take. While the concept is strong, execution depends entirely on the digitizing quality and your specific machine setup.
- Verify Hoop Size Compatibility: The product description mentions this is part of a collection, but does not specify dimensions. You must confirm the exact hoop size requirements on the Creative Fabrica product page before purchasing. Ensure it fits your primary production hoop to avoid re-hooping or resizing, which can distort stitch density.
- Assess Stitch Density: Faceted designs often require complex fill stitches to create the illusion of depth and shine. High density looks premium but can cause fabric distortion on lighter materials like t-shirts or thin towels. Always run a test stitch-out on your intended substrate. You may need to adjust tension or use a heavier stabilizer to support the weight of the thread.
- Thread Color Strategy: Tanzanite is a unique violet-blue stone. Standard embroidery threads might not capture this perfectly. Review your thread colors inventory to find the closest match, or consider blending two shades (a purple and a blue) in the same needle if your machine allows, or using a variegated thread to mimic the gem's natural color shift. Accurate color representation is key for customer satisfaction.
- Licensing Confirmation: Never assume usage rights. Check the specific license terms for this commercial embroidery file. Confirm whether you are permitted to sell physical embroidered items, and if there are any limits on production volume. Also, verify if the license covers the use of the design in digital mockups for marketing purposes.
- Readability Check: Since the words “Tanzanite Birthstone” are integral to the design, ensure the font remains legible when scaled down for smaller items like patches or baby bibs. If the text becomes unreadable below a certain size, note that minimum dimension in your internal production guidelines to avoid wasted materials.
